titleOfInvention Method to isolate macromolecules using magnetically attractable beads which do not specifically bind the macromolecules
abstract A method of recovering a biopolymer from solution involves the use of magnetically attractable beads which do not specifically bind the polymer. The beads are suspended in the solution. Then the polymer is precipitated out of solution and becomes non-specifically associated with the beads. When the beads are magnetically drawn down, the polymer is drawn down with them. The polymer can subsequently be resolubilized and separated from the beads.
